Key Responsibilities
Support project spatial needs includingWebGIS, Cartographic map production, spatialanalysisand information management
Design and implement spatial solutionsusing ArcGIS Pro and ArcGIS Enterprise tailored to project needs
Supportthe design and deployment of spatial tools,dashboardsand web-based applications
Collaborate with geospatial teams across Australia and New Zealand to develop, test and scale innovative spatial solutions
Collaboratewithnon geospatialprofessionalsthrough project workwith intent to understand their workflows and seek optimisations or applications of GIS to their disciplines
Developand supportautomated geospatial workflows and data transformation processes using Python and FME
Provide technical leadershipand guidanceon efficientgeospatial workflows on complex multi-disciplinary projects
Contribute to strategic planning and capability growth within the geospatial team
What are we looking for from you?
To be successful in this role, you will have:
Bachelor’s degree in Spatial Science, Geography, GeospatialEngineeringor similar field
2-8years’ experience working with Geographic Information Systems preferably in consultancy
A strong professional work ethic and commitment to health and safety for yourself, your team,subcontractorsand clients
Experienceinmap production,spatial data analysis and digital map creation using mapping platforms
Exposure to automation tools such as Model Builder, FME, and Python
Proficiencyin ESRI’s ArcGIS tools including ArcGIS Pro and ArcGIS Enterprise
Strong communicationand collaboration skills.
